Hello,

some processes on my node use a lot of CPU. How do I find out which VE runs which process?
In top or with ps aux I only see this:

28910 33 15 0 35948 8608 3288 S 89.5 0.1 0:21.07 /usr/bin/php5-cgi

So the process root is /usr/bin/php5-cgi, but I still don't know which VE executes it. The load of al VEs is normal, so I also can't find it with veid,laverage.

On HN node you can use vzpid tool
for example if 8480 is a pid
#vzpid 8480
Pid VEID Name
8480 210 httpd

or use htop with ctid feature:

htop -> setup (f2) -> colums -> choose ctid on right side -> quit (f10)

you can sort via ctid as well
